Latter-day Saints Church History Museum
Salt Lake City, USA


The Latter-day Saints Church History Museum is a modern facility dedicated to the history and culture of the Mormon faith, located adjacent to the Salt Lake Temple. Opened in 2009, the museum features artifacts, artwork, and multimedia exhibits that showcase the story of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ints from its beginnings in the early 19th century.
Plan for at least an hour to navigate the engaging displays, many of which are suitable for all ages. The museum is ideally visited in the morning when it's less crowded, and it’s just a short walk from Liberty Park and the Utah State Capitol, adding convenience to your exploration of this vibrant area.
